Rental Yield Calculations and Cash Flow Analysis
Successful rental property investment begins with accurate financial analysis. Calculate your potential gross rental yield by dividing annual rental income by the property's purchase price. In Bend's market, aim for properties that generate at least 8-10% gross rental yields to ensure positive cash flow after expenses.
Factor in property taxes (approximately 1.2% of assessed value in Deschutes County), insurance costs, property management fees (typically 8-12% of rental income), and maintenance reserves when calculating net operating income. DSCR Loans: The Investor's Favorite
Debt Service Coverage Ratio (DSCR) loans have revolutionized investment property loans for beginners Bend market participants. Unlike traditional loans that focus heavily on personal income, DSCR loans evaluate the property's cash flow potential. This makes them ideal for new investors who may not have extensive W-2 income but have identified profitable rental properties.
DSCR loans typically require 20-25% down and focus on whether the property's rental income can cover the mortgage payments. For Bend's strong rental market, this often works in investors' favor, as vacation rentals and long-term rentals both command premium rates in the area.

Credit Score and Financial History Requirements
Most Bend lenders offering investment property loans for beginners Bend require a minimum credit score of 620-640, though competitive rates typically start at 680 or higher. Unlike traditional homeowner loans, investment property financing demands stricter credit standards due to increased risk factors. Lenders will scrutinize your payment history, debt-to-income ratios, and overall financial stability more thoroughly than conventional mortgage applications.
Your credit report should demonstrate consistent payment patterns across all existing debts, including credit cards, auto loans, and student loans. Any recent bankruptcies, foreclosures, or short sales can significantly impact your eligibility for investment property financing, often requiring waiting periods of 2-4 years depending on the circumstances.
Down Payment and Cash Reserve Expectations
When exploring how to buy rental property first time OR investors discover that down payment requirements are substantially higher than primary residence purchases. Most Bend lenders require 20-25% down for investment properties, with some specialty programs accepting as little as 15% for qualified borrowers.
Beyond the down payment, lenders typically require 2-6 months of mortgage payments held in cash reserves after closing. This requirement ensures you can handle vacancy periods or unexpected maintenance expenses without defaulting on your investment property loan. For a $400,000 Bend rental property, expect to have $80,000-$100,000 in down payment plus an additional $8,000-$12,000 in reserves.
Income Verification and Debt-to-Income Ratios
Bend lenders require comprehensive income documentation, including two years of tax returns, recent pay stubs, and bank statements. Self-employed borrowers face additional scrutiny and may need certified financial statements or profit-and-loss documentation prepared by licensed accountants.
Your debt-to-income ratio (DTI) must typically remain below 43-45% when including the new investment property payment. However, experienced lenders may consider projected rental income when calculating DTI, typically using 75% of expected rental income to account for vacancy and maintenance factors.

Financing Your House Hacking Strategy
Understanding house hacking loans Bend options is crucial for success. FHA loans often serve as the foundation for house hacking ventures, allowing qualified borrowers to purchase properties with as little as 3.5% down payment. These loans can be used for properties with up to four units, provided the buyer commits to living in one unit as their primary residence for at least one year.
Conventional loans also support house hacking strategies, particularly for properties that may not qualify for FHA financing. While conventional loans typically require higher down payments, they offer more flexibility in property types and conditions, making them valuable tools when learning how to buy rental property first time OR anywhere in the Pacific Northwest.
